The national on risk management to be developed
Azerbaijan Risk Professionals Association (ARPA) and audit consulting company MAK Azerbaijan Ltd will jointly support the formation and development of a risk management culture in Azerbaijan. Yesterday they signed a five-year cooperation agreement between the two organizations.
According to the document, the parties will develop and implement a national program of risk management. The agenda also includes holding of regular joint forums, conferences and meetings of "round tables" on risks. Also planned is joint research and risk analysis.
This is not the first fruits of partnership between the two organizations this year - on 23 October, a joint presentation took place on the management of a variety of risks of local businesses, including financial reporting and internal supervision, management, international financial reporting standards, preventive measures against fraud, etc. - 17D-

Azerbaijani internet service providers Aztelekom and Baktelekom will introduce substantial changes to their pricing structure starting August 15, the companies announced today. Under the new tariffs, the minimum internet speed will rise to 100 Mbit/s, with the cost per Mbit/s decreasing from 0.45 AZN to 0.25 AZN. As a result, monthly charges will be set at 25 AZN for 100 Mbit/s, 30 AZN for 150 Mbit/s, and 36 AZN for 250 Mbit/s.

Independent experts suggest that Azerbaijan may be on the verge of another devaluation of its currency, the manat, due to a shrinking trade and payment surplus. The anticipated economic adjustments come amidst a decline in foreign currency inflows and reduced oil production.
